Time of Update: 2018-12-08
json 在上篇文章已有詳細介紹,json的既簡單易懂,又傳輸迅速。並且能和javascript很好的融為一體。 在不需要添加jar的前提下,能夠很好完成jsp分頁問題。 下面具體介紹分頁執行個體:效果,採用jsp+servlet技術 首先:編寫一個javaBean User.java 複製代碼 代碼如下:package bean; public class User { private int id; private String name; private String password;
Time of Update: 2018-12-08
檔案上傳: 複製代碼 代碼如下:public class UploadServlet extends HttpServlet{ @Override prot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{ doPost(req, resp); } @Override protected void
Time of Update: 2018-12-08
文章目錄 什麼是Servlet和JSPMVC模型 什麼是Servlet和JSP用Java開發Web應用程式時用到的技術主要有兩種,即Servlet和JSP。 Servlet是在伺服器端執行的Java程式,一個被稱為Servlet容器的程式(其實就是伺服器) 負責執行Java程式。而JSP(Java Server Page)則是一個頁面, 由JSP容器負責執行。Servlet和JSP兩者最大的區別就是,Servlet以Java程式為主,
Time of Update: 2018-12-08
文章目錄 HttpServletRequestHttpServletResponse樣本程式 HttpServlet先來複習一下上一節提到的類結構圖:可以看到,HttpServlet繼承了GenericServlet,不過它也是一個抽象類別, 不能直接使用,只能繼承它。HttpServlet中常用的方法有兩個:doGetvoid doGet(HttpServletRequest request, HttpServletResponse
Time of Update: 2018-12-08
添加JSP自訂標籤:先添加一個tld檔案到WEB-INF檔案夾中<?xml version="1.0" encoding="UTF-8" ?><taglib x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ee
Time of Update: 2018-12-08
jsp中定義實體bean<jsp:useBean id="clu" class="cn.domain.CacluBean"></jsp:useBean><jsp:getProperty property="propertyname" name =
Time of Update: 2018-12-08
jsp頁面: 複製代碼 代碼如下:var clientTel = $("#clientTel").val(); var activityId = $("#activityId").val(); $.ajax({ type : "post",//發送方式 url : "/arweb/reserve/saveCode.action",// 路徑 data : "clientTel="+clientTel+"&activityId="+activityId , success:
Time of Update: 2018-12-08
jsp 代碼如下: 複製代碼 代碼如下:<a id="wd" name="wd" href="javascript:void(0);" onclick="wdQuery()">文檔</a> <a id="xw" name="xw" href="javascript:void(0);" onclick="xwQuery()">公司新聞</a> 複製代碼 代碼如下:function wdQuery(){ var keywords=
Time of Update: 2018-12-08
複製代碼 代碼如下:<%@ page language="java" pageEncoding="gbk"%><%@ page contentType="image/jpeg" import="java.awt.*,java.awt.image.*,java.util.*,javax.imageio.*" %><%!Color getRandColor(int fc,int bc){//給定範圍獲得隨機顏色 Random random = new
Time of Update: 2018-12-08
jsp運算式方式: 複製代碼 代碼如下:<center> <table border="1"> <% for (int i = 1; i <= 9; i++) { %> <tr> <% for (int j = 1; j <= 9; j++) { %> <td> <% if (j <= i) { %> <%=i%>*<%=i%>=<%=i * j%> <
Time of Update: 2018-12-08
1、mysql的limit關鍵字 (DAO)select * from tablename limit startPoint, numberPerPage;tablename 就是要分頁顯示的那張表的名稱;startPoint 就是起始的位置 -1;numberPerPage 就是一頁顯示的條數。例如: select * from comment limit 20,5;則是從comment表中抽取21~25號評論:2、jQuery load函數
Time of Update: 2018-12-08
好長時間不看,又把基礎只是給忘了。今天好好的再看看。呵呵呵......溫故而知新啊!!!1.RequestDispatcher.forward()――轉寄 是在伺服器端起作用,當使用forward()時, Servlet engine傳遞HTTP請求從當前的Servlet or JSP到另外一個Servlet,JSP 或普通HTML檔案,也即你的 form提交至a.jsp,在a.jsp用到了forward()重新導向至b.jsp,此時form提交的所有資訊在
Time of Update: 2018-12-08
jsp頁面: 複製代碼 代碼如下:$(document).ready(function() { setInterval(function myTimer() { //alert('a'); getViews(); },1000); }); //播放 function getViews(){ $.ajax({ 'url':"${pageContext.request.contextPath}/video/getVideos.action?r="+Math.random()+"&open=1
Time of Update: 2018-12-08
複製代碼 代碼如下:<tr> <td height="60px;" width="20%" align="right" valign="top"> <font style="font-weight: bold;">標題:</font> </td> <td height="60px;" width="80%" align="left" valign="top"> <a id="
Time of Update: 2018-12-08
JSP內建對象之request對象用戶端的請求資訊被封裝在request對象中,通過它才能瞭解到客戶的需求,然後做出響應。它是HttpServletRequest類的執行個體。序號 方 法 說 明 1 object getAttribute(String name) 返回指定屬性的屬性值 2 Enumeration getAttributeNames() 返回所有可用屬性名稱的枚舉 3 String getCharacterEncoding() 返回字元編碼方式 4 int
Time of Update: 2018-12-08
Taglib指令介紹Taglib指令,其實就是定義一個標籤庫以及自訂標籤的首碼。比如struts中支援的標籤庫,html標籤庫、bean標籤庫、logic標籤庫。其中的具體的實現方式,我們不過多介紹,我們給大家從宏觀的角度以及解決其中的疑痛點,後面會大家介紹相應的學習資料。除了struts的標籤庫,我們常見還有jstl標籤庫。這樣在介面jsp中引入其中的標籤庫或者標籤庫檔案,然後才可以正常使用其中定義的標籤。複製代碼 代碼如下:<%@ taglib prefix ="bean" uri=
Time of Update: 2018-12-08
首先要在你登入的頁面的某個地方,寫上一個超級連結: 複製代碼 代碼如下:<a href="exit.jsp" target="_top">退出</a> 讓它連結到exit.jsp頁面去,然後建立一個exit.jsp頁面在其body中寫上如下代碼: 複製代碼 代碼如下:<% session.invalidate(); %> <jsp:forward page="login.jsp"></jsp:forward>
Time of Update: 2018-12-08
jsp+ajax實現無重新整理,滑鼠離開文字框即驗證使用者名稱,操作如下:建立一個輸入頁面,起名為input.jsp, 複製代碼 代碼如下:<%@ page contentType="text/html; charset=utf-8"%> <html> <head> <title>jsp+ajax實現無重新整理_滑鼠離開文字框即驗證使用者名稱</title> <meta http-equiv="Content-Type"
Time of Update: 2018-12-08
2013-1-16 10:35:49 org.apache.tomcat.util.http.Parameters processParameters 警告: Parameters: Character decoding failed. Parameter 'id' with value '%u8BA2%u5355' has been ignored. Note that the name and value quoted here may corrupted due to the
Time of Update: 2018-12-08
複製代碼 代碼如下:<script> function setImagePreview() { var docObj=document.getElementById("doc"); var imgObjPreview=document.getElementById("preview"); if(docObj.files && docObj.files[0]){ //Firefox下,直接設img屬性 imgObjPreview.style.display =